Genetic influences on externalizing psychopathology overlap with cognitive functioning and show developmental
Josephine Mollon1, Emma E M Knowles1, Samuel R Mathias1
1Department of Psychiatry, Boston Children's Hospital, Harvard Medical School, Boston, Massachusetts, USA.
Genetic factors influence externalizing behaviors, showing overlap with cognitive abilities like reasoning and memory. These genetic influences decrease with age, suggesting earlier gene discovery is more effective.
Area of Science:
- Psychiatric genetics
- Developmental psychology
- Cognitive neuroscience
Background:
- Genetic underpinnings of early psychopathology and their relationship with cognition remain unclear.
- Developmental changes in genetic influences on psychopathology require further investigation.
Purpose of the Study:
- To investigate genetic influences on psychopathology factors in youth.
- To examine the genetic overlap between psychopathology and cognitive abilities.
- To determine if genetic influences on psychopathology vary across development.
Main Methods:
- Utilized data from the Philadelphia Neurodevelopmental Cohort (N=9,421, ages 8-21).
- Generated psychopathology factors using a bifactor model from psychiatric interview data.
- Conducted genetic analyses (heritability, genetic correlations) on European American participants (N=4,662).
- Performed Gene × Age analyses to assess developmental variation in genetic influences.
Main Results:
- Externalizing behaviors were heritable (h²=0.46), unlike other factors.
- Externalizing showed significant genetic correlations with various cognitive functions, including reasoning, memory, and general cognitive ability.
- Gene × Age analyses indicated decreasing genetic variance and increasing environmental variance for externalizing behaviors with age.
Conclusions:
- Cognitive impairments may serve as an endophenotype for externalizing psychopathology, aiding in understanding its pathophysiology.
- Reduced genetic variance in older individuals suggests that gene discovery for externalizing behaviors is more promising in childhood.
